Sign #1: Your Engagement Metrics Are Trending Down

If your team is showing up—but not showing interest—it’s your first red flag.

What to Look For:

  • Team meeting attendance dropping below 70%
  • Training replay completion rates falling off
  • One-word answers or silence during discussions
  • Agents who used to contribute… now checked out

Action Step:
Track attendance and participation over a 60-day period. If the trend is downward, it’s time to inject a new voice, new ideas, and new energy.


Sign #2: Your Training Library Feels Like a Loop

If your playbook hasn’t changed in a year, your agents have already tuned out. This isn’t a leadership flaw—it’s content fatigue.

What to Watch For:

  • Topics that feel repetitive
  • Feedback like, “We’ve done this already”
  • New agents are engaged, but veterans are drifting
  • Your content calendar hasn’t been refreshed in 6+ months

Action Step:
Audit your last 12 months of training. Highlight repeated or outdated topics. Then, look for an outside expert who can modernize your playbook with proven, tech-driven strategies.


Sign #3: Morale Tanks When the Market Shifts

Even the best leaders struggle to lift morale when the market turns. Interest rates rise. Buyers hesitate. Sellers stall. Suddenly, your team’s belief system cracks.

What to Notice:

  • More negativity or blame in meetings
  • Quiet disengagement or ghosting
  • Drop in prospecting activity or listing pitches
  • Low energy even after incentives

How to Choose the Right Speaker (and Maximize the Impact)

✔ Match the message to the moment.
Don’t book a mindset talk when your team needs systems—or vice versa. Identify the actual gap.

✔ Prime your team before the event.
Build excitement. Frame it as growth, not “fixing.”

✔ Integrate the learning afterward.
The best results come when the session’s takeaways are baked into your scorecards, meetings, or systems.

✔ Keep it focused.
A powerful 90-minute workshop can outperform an all-day agenda. Depth beats volume.
